Human Sexuality/Counseling

Knowledge of normal sexual development and sexual dysfunctions are important for the professional mental health counselor. This course will cover sociocultural foundations of the study of sexuality, basic anatomy and physiology, major sexual dysfunctions and disorders, diagnosis and treatment, and the counselor's role.
